Roy Keane slams Man Utd star who looked'like a schoolboy'in 1-1 draw vs West Ham, he helped'bring the levels down'

Manchester United legend Roy Keane was not happy with the team’s performance in the 1-1 draw against West Ham.

Another home fixture, another disappointment.

Ruben Amorim‘s side gave up a 1-0 lead and had to settle for a 1-1 draw at Old Trafford, after conceding a goal from a set piece.

It was a pretty flat display, where United played well at the end of the first half and start of the second, but relinquished control of the game too easily.

Amorim’s substitutions were a contributory factor, with goalscorer Diogo Dalot among the players taken off when the team were leading.

Roy Keane criticises Mason Mount

Manchester United legend Roy Keane spoke with his usual ruthless tone after the team failed to get all three points.

The main subject of Keane’s ire was Ruben Amorim’s ineffective substitutes, and one player got it in the neck more than most.

Keane picked out Manchester United’s number seven, Mason Mount, pointing out how he failed to take command of the game when he came on.

He told Sky Sports: “Mason [Mount], he comes on sometimes, and I know sometimes players seem to take longer to get up to speed than others. He was like a schoolboy out there.

“You’re looking for players to come on with a bit of presence and say, ‘Give me the ball.'”

He added: “The substitutes, if anything, brought the levels down for United. That seemed to be the case tonight.”

Referring back to Mount, he said: “Especially when he scored in the last game, you know what I mean? So, he should be energized, he should be positive and everything.

“‘Here, you’re on stage for 20 minutes, we are one up, so you don’t have to do anything spectacular, but keep the ball, get us some free kicks, corners, whatever it is.'”

As a player with stacks of experience at the top level, demands on Mason Mount are always high, even though his spell at United is still trying to get off the ground.

Ruben Amorim did him no favours, he would have been better off starting Mount after his weekend winner, with Matheus Cunha failing to take advantage of his starting opportunity.

What Ruben Amorim said about the substitutions

Ruben Amorim brought on five substitutes during the game, bringing on Leny Yoro, Patrick Dorgu, Manuel Ugarte, Mason Mount, and Lisandro Martinez.

Amorim told Sky Sports after the game: “It is not an excuse. Players change but we know what to do. We need to close the game.”

Keane added that he lacks faith in Manchester United to win convincingly and needs to be proved otherwise.

“Find a way to win, grind out a result. It couldn’t get any worse than last year.

“Defensively and in midfield, there are huge questions. I wouldn’t trust or believe in this team that they can get results.”
